Implementation Plan for the High-Quality Development of the Copper Industry (2025-2027)
Copper is an important basic raw material and a strategic resource relating to the national economy, people's livelihood, and the development of the national economy. In recent years, the scale of China's copper industry has continued to grow, the industrial structure continues to be optimized, and the level of equipment technology has been continuously improved. It has initially formed a number of internationally competitive industrial clusters, which have strongly supported the development of strategic emerging industries such as new energy and next-generation information technology. However, at the same time, problems such as insufficient resource guarantee capacity and the need to optimize the industrial structure have come to the fore. In order to promote the high-quality development of the copper industry, better support the development of key industrial chains in the manufacturing industry and meet people's needs for a better life, this implementation plan was formulated. The implementation period is 2025 to 2027.

By 2027, the level of resilience and safety of the industrial chain supply chain will improve markedly. The ability to guarantee copper raw materials is constantly being strengthened, and efforts are being made to increase the amount of domestic copper resources by 5% to 10%, and to further improve the level of recycling of recycled copper. The level of technological innovation continues to improve, breaking through a number of green and efficient development and utilization of key processes and high-end new materials for copper resources, and the manufacturing capacity of high-end equipment has been significantly enhanced. Cultivate a number of high-quality enterprises in the copper industry, and further optimize the industrial structure. Looking forward to 2035, the industrial chain level will be world-leading, and a high-quality development situation will be fully formed. The ability to guarantee copper raw materials has been significantly enhanced, and technological equipment innovation capabilities and material application levels are at the top of the world, forming a development pattern with reasonable industrial structure, high level of technological innovation, good quality and efficiency, and strong global competitiveness.
II. Key tasks
(1) Strengthening the domestic raw material guarantee base
1. Promote increased domestic resource storage and production. Firmly push forward a new round of prospecting breakthrough strategic actions, strengthen the investigation and exploration of copper resources in key domestic mining zones, and add a batch of copper ore resource reserves that can be developed. Actively carry out prospecting at the deep edge of existing mines, extend the service life of mines, carry out surveys on mine pollution conditions, and collaborate to carry out mine pollution control and ecological restoration. Promote the construction of copper resource bases in key regions such as Tibet, Xinjiang, Yunnan, and Heilongjiang, build a number of large and medium-sized copper mines, and continuously raise the level of copper development, utilization, and safe production. On the premise of protecting the ecological environment and ensuring safe production, speed up approval processes such as copper mine development projects, EIA, and safety facility design review, and accelerate the expansion of production projects and the construction of new projects. (The Ministry of Natural Resources, the National Development and Reform Commission, the Ministry of Industry and Information Technology, the Ministry of Ecology and Environment, the Ministry of Emergency Management, and the State Mine Safety Administration are responsible according to the division of responsibilities)
2. Encourage comprehensive utilization of mineral resources. Increase the evaluation of associated resources such as rhenium in copper ores, strengthen the comprehensive utilization of associated resources such as molybdenum, gold, and silver, improve resource extraction and recovery rate, and comprehensive utilization rate, and achieve efficient development and utilization of all elements associated with copper ore. Encourage copper mining enterprises to mine both rich and poor, and strengthen the reduction, recycling, and harmless disposal of copper tailings and smelting slag. Promote large-scale beneficiation equipment, green beneficiation agents, and comprehensive utilization technology for low-grade copper ore and tailings. 3. Strengthen recycling of renewable resources. Strengthen copper scrap processing and distribution capabilities, and improve the level of fine treatment and direct utilization. Support the establishment of large-scale copper scrap recycling bases and industrial agglomeration areas, promote the integrated development of copper scrap recycling, dismantling, processing, classification and distribution, and promote the intensive and high-value development of the recycled copper industry. Encourage copper smelting enterprises to establish recycling networks for copper scrap resources and use existing copper smelting systems to treat copper-containing renewable resources. Cultivate a group of copper scrap processing and utilization enterprises that meet regulatory requirements and are highly competitive, and copper smelting enterprises that use copper-containing renewable resources. (2) Promoting structural adjustment
4. Promote the orderly development of copper smelting. Promote the transformation of copper smelting development from scale expansion of production capacity to improvement of quality and efficiency, strictly implement relevant policy requirements such as industry, environmental protection, energy efficiency, safety, etc., and implement new and expanded copper smelting projects according to the benchmark level of the “Energy Efficiency Benchmark Level and Benchmark Level for Key Industrial Areas (2023 Edition)”, encourage new and expanded copper smelting projects to build at a high level compared to the standard conditions of the copper smelting industry, and promote energy efficiency levels. Implement requirements such as total pollutant control, regional reduction, and carbon emission reduction. In principle, a new copper smelting project must be equipped with a corresponding proportion of equity copper concentrate production capacity. Resolutely eliminate outdated processes. 5. Optimize the industrial layout. Implement major national regional strategies, coordinated regional development strategies, and main functional area strategies, take into account production factors such as resources, energy, environment, and transportation in an integrated manner, guide the orderly transfer of production capacity to regions with resource and energy advantages and environmental carrying capacity, promote the withdrawal of inefficient production capacity, and stop adding additional copper smelting production capacity in key areas for air pollution prevention and control. Encourage the combined development of copper smelting with industries such as chemicals and building materials, and achieve local transformation of by-products such as sulfur. Support the cultivation of advanced manufacturing clusters in the copper deep processing industry. 8. Accelerate key technical research. It supports mining technology research such as safe and efficient mining of complex deposits and ultra-deep well mines, large-scale green and low-carbon intelligent harvesting in ultra-high altitudes and extremely cold regions, and efficient mineral processing of low-grade difficult minerals. Guide copper manufacturers to work with research institutes and downstream application companies to develop preparation technology and industrialization of high-performance copper alloy materials such as high-purity oxygen-free copper, high-end rolled copper foil, and high-end lead frame materials. Accelerate the development of key equipment such as next-generation continuous casting and continuous rolling precision copper tube production lines, U-shaped continuous extrusion online flattening equipment for copper sheet blanks, rolling copper foil mills, roller-bottom continuous annealing furnaces, automatic strip cleaning lines, and air cushion annealing furnaces. (4) Promoting green and intelligent industrial development
9. Support green transformation and upgrading. Strengthen in-depth air pollution control in the copper smelting industry, accelerate the conversion of industrial furnaces using highly polluting fuels to electricity, natural gas, etc., build a number of benchmark enterprises that have reached the A level of environmental performance, encourage C-level enterprises with environmental performance to strengthen management and raise their performance levels. By the end of 2025, all copper smelting production capacity in key air pollution prevention and control regions will complete environmental performance grade A transformation. Strengthen the control of heavy metal pollution in the copper smelting field, treat solid waste such as arsenic-containing smelting slag and soot harmlessly, and promote the recycling of water resources and waste heat recovery at medium and low temperatures. Guide enterprises and parks to improve the top 5 environmental performance management, and build a number of green mines, green factories and green parks. Build a green and low-carbon public service platform for the non-ferrous metals industry and accelerate the promotion of a number of energy-saving and low-carbon technologies. Column 2
The key direction of green technology focuses on promoting technologies and equipment such as green cycle biological copper extraction technology for low-grade copper ore, complete green and efficient short-process large-scale flotation equipment technology, continuous copper smelting technology, double furnace continuous copper smelting technology, anode furnace pure oxygen combustion technology, and low-carbon treatment technology for waste copper.

Column 3
The key direction of digital intelligent transformation and upgrading is for copper mining enterprises, improving infrastructure network construction, building digital resource management systems and comprehensive production control platforms, digitally transforming mining trucks, drilling rigs, rock drilling rigs, scrapers, flotation machines and other infrastructure, and realizing the intelligent operation of mineral processing production systems. For copper smelters, accelerate the implementation of automated transformation of key processes such as batching, smelting, refining, and electrolysis, realize real-time data monitoring, sensing and unified collection and management, and improve intelligent management functions such as automatic control, production management, equipment management, and environmental safety management. For copper processing plants, accelerate the automated transformation of key processes such as melting, casting, rolling, extrusion, annealing, and refining, realize real-time production monitoring, sensing and data collection, and build a centralized control center integrating automation, informatization, and centralized management models to achieve centralized control of production and operation, centralized production line control, and public assistance.

12. Raise the level of foreign trade cooperation. Encourage the export of advanced processed products such as new high-end copper-based materials and products. Encourage copper smelting enterprises to sign long-term procurement agreements with foreign mining companies to increase imports of primary products such as crude copper and anodized copper. Implement the import policy for recycled copper raw materials and encourage the import of high-quality recycled copper raw materials that meet the requirements of national policies. Give full play to the price discovery role of futures to provide a guarantee for enterprise risk management.
